[receiver/vcenter] Remove vcenter.cluster.name resource attribute from standalone Host resources #32549

Conversation

StefanKurek
Copy link
Contributor

Description:
vcenter.cluster.name attribute is removed from all Host resources that have a ComputeResource parent (vs. a ClusterComputeResource) parent.

This helps to not cause confusion by making standalone hosts look like clustered hosts.
